Wonderful, little family run inn in the middle of nowhere. Very friendly family who will spend time with you if you are so inclined. It's far from Drake Bay, 5.5 km and 20+ minutes from the main beach by taxi. They will go out of their way to make sure you have a memorable experience on the Osa peninsula. If you are on foot, be prepared for long, rewarding walks. Try the horseback riding which is a bargain at US$25 p/p for a half day. Stayed in March, 2015.

If Drake Bay is in the "middle of nowhere" then Casa Drake is at th "edge of nowhere". Casa Drake is a beautiful family owned and managed guest house. The family that runs it is very friendly, but doesn't speak a word of English, so you'll need someone in your group who can converse at least a little in Spanish. The house itself is very pretty, with simple dark wood decor. The big problem is its remote location - a 25 minute taxi ride from the town of Drake Bay on a very bumpy dirt road and across a thigh deep river that requires a 4x4 SUV or Pickup to ford. Cost each way into town is about $8 US. Also Drake Bay itself is not accessible by car unless you are driving a 4x4 as you will have to ford 5 rivers. We only made it past 4 in our sedan.

Drake Bay in Costa Rica is an incredible place, and the people at Casa Drake are really lovely and caring. This to be aware of: - This hotel only accepts cash payments for your board. Having enough USD before you even arrive in Drake Bay is a must. There are no ATMS in the area. - There are 8 guest rooms that all share 4 bathrooms. 2 bathrooms have cold water showers - Meals are $USD15 per person. There is no menu, they are homecooked and shared amongst the guests. There are no other nearby options for food. Make the hotel aware in advance if you have allergies or food preferences. - This is a rural place, its far out of town - 20min taxi ride/$10USD per person. You need to take taxis everywhere, its too far to walk. - They don't really speak English. You need some basic Spanish. GOOD: - They are helpful to arrange tours for you in advance. Take their advice and book through them, it will save you a lot of trouble. - They really do care for you and really go out of their way to help. - Their home cooked food is really lovely. Simple, but lovely. - There are several incredible beaches 15min taxi ride away, and worth the trip. - There is a lovely space with hammocks for chilling out. - The rooms all have lovely balconies and you can see amazing birds just outside your window. - Take their advice, and do the 8 hour tour to Sirena and the Corcovado National Park - it's amazing and worth it.
